Swift Code details for CBQAQAQACGT
The Swift Code CBQAQAQACGT is assigned to THE COMMERCIAL BANK (Q.S.C) located in 380 AL MARKHIYAH STREET, DOHA, Qatar.
This SWIFT/BIC code is used for international wire transfers and follows the standard format for secure cross-border payments. Branch details include postal code 3232, status: Active. This Swift Code CBQAQAQACGT has been validated and confirmed as active for banking transactions.
